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Child care is a field that continues to grow, as the economy forces more and more people with children to work outside the home. This guide to finding a meaningful job in child care provides the basic needs of any job seeker: how to craft a successful resume and cover letter, how to dress for an interview, and how to be the best worker you can be. It covers all of the bases, including getting safety certification, licensing, and handling tax concerns when the time comes.
